Salado village, Texas Citizen Voting-age Population By Race and Ethnicity in 2024 (ACS-5Yrs)

Updated on March 27, 2026.

Based on the US Census Bureau's special tabulation from the ACS 5-year estimates, in 2024, the citizen voting-age population for Salado village, Texas was 1.70K. The Non-Hispanic White Alone ethnicity group had the highest citizen voting-age population (1.46K) and constituted 86.17% of the total.

The Hispanic or Latino of All Races ethnicity group had the second highest citizen voting-age population (184) and constituted 10.83% of the total. The Non-Hispanic Two Or More Races ethnicity group had the third highest (43), constituting 2.53% of the total citizen voting-age population.

Salado village, Texas Citizen Voting-age Population By Race and Ethnicity in 2024
0 of 0
Ethnicity Voting-age Population % of Voting-age Pop.
Non-Hispanic White Alone 1464 86.17
Hispanic or Latino of All Races 184 10.83
Non-Hispanic Two Or More Races 43 2.53
Non-Hispanic American Indian and Alaska Native Alone 9 0.53
Non-Hispanic Asian Alone 8 0.47
Non-Hispanic Black or African American Alone 5 0.29
